Gradient and jacobian matrix
The Jacobian of a vector-valued function in several variables generalizes the gradient of a scalar-valued function in several variables, which in turn generalizes the derivative of a scalar-valued function of a single variable. In other words, the Jacobian matrix of a scalar-valued function in several variables is (the transpose of) its gradient and the gradient of a scalar-valued function of a single variable is its derivative. WebWhile it is a good exercise to compute the gradient of a neural network with re-spect to a single parameter (e.g., a single element in a weight matrix), in practice this tends to be quite slow. Instead, it is more e cient to keep everything in ma-trix/vector form. The basic building block of vectorized gradients is the Jacobian Matrix.
